然而,在使用Hyper-V的过程中,用户可能会遇到各种错误代码,其中0x8错误代码便是一个较为常见且令人头疼的问题
本文将深入探讨Hyper-V开启0x8错误代码的原因、影响以及提供一系列行之有效的解决方案,帮助您快速排除故障,恢复Hyper-V的正常运行
一、Hyper-V 0x8错误代码概述 0x8错误代码,在Hyper-V的上下文中,通常指的是在尝试启动虚拟机、配置虚拟网络适配器或执行其他虚拟化相关操作时遇到的一个通用错误
这个错误并不指向一个具体的子错误,而是一个较为宽泛的错误类别,可能由多种原因引起
因此,解决0x8错误代码的关键在于准确识别其背后的具体原因,然后采取针对性的解决措施
二、0x8错误代码的常见原因 1.资源不足:虚拟机的运行依赖于宿主机提供的CPU、内存、存储和网络等资源
当宿主机资源紧张时,虚拟机可能无法成功启动或运行,从而触发0x8错误
2.配置错误:虚拟机的配置设置不当,如内存分配过多、虚拟硬盘格式不支持等,都可能导致启动失败并显示0x8错误
3.权限问题:Hyper-V要求管理员权限才能执行大多数操作
如果用户权限不足,尝试启动虚拟机或修改配置时可能会遇到0x8错误
4.软件冲突:某些安装在宿主机上的软件可能与Hyper-V不兼容,导致虚拟化操作失败
5.硬件兼容性问题:部分硬件(如网络适配器、存储设备)可能不完全支持Hyper-V的虚拟化技术,从而引发错误
6.Hyper-V服务异常:Hyper-V服务未正确启动或运行异常,也可能导致虚拟机无法启动,并显示0x8错误
三、解决0x8错误代码的步骤 1. 检查系统资源 - 内存和CPU:确保宿主机有足够的内存和CPU资源供虚拟机使用
可以通过任务管理器或性能监视器查看资源使用情况
- 存储空间:检查虚拟硬盘所在的磁盘空间是否充足,确保没有磁盘空间不足的问题
2. 验证虚拟机配置 - 内存分配:检查虚拟机的内存分配是否合理,避免分配超过宿主机可用内